Output 317ddeadb3b52413d97778f344a574b26351ad8e5f52e646dfb8db69b4c77c07:5

value
119969292
script pubkey
OP_0 OP_PUSHBYTES_32 81ded54f498a027e0b37adebec8b59e2442ff897557eac9bd45b0a23dbe1c8b4
address
bc1qs80d2n6f3gp8uzeh4h47ez6eufzzl7yh24l2ex75tv9z8klpez6q2v9ef4
transaction
317ddeadb3b52413d97778f344a574b26351ad8e5f52e646dfb8db69b4c77c07
spent
true